Travelling to Italy

Link – Pisa Airport

The closest airport to the city of Lucca is located in Pisa ​(25 minutes by train). 

Link – Trains

From Pisa airport you take the train heading to Pisa Centrale station (“PisaMover”), where you need to change trains for Lucca.​

Link – ​Florence Airport
Alternatively there is an airport located in Florence (1 hour 20 minutes by train). From Florence airport, you need to reach the train station in Florence center (Santa Maria Novella) and then take a train or bus (bus station closeby) heading to Lucca. There is a tram line that connects the airport with the city centre, or you can take a taxi (approximately €25).
